You should find out from your IT department if the users in your<br />

organization have these enabled in their browsers.<br />

For some functions, <strong>Moodle</strong> offers an interface that is more accessible for<br />

sight-impaired users. If you are testing your site for a visually impaired<br />

user, set this to Yes for one of your test accounts.<br />

These fields are required. If you use names for your test accounts that<br />

sound real, consider giving your test accounts a fictional city, like<br />

"Testville". It might make it easier to find the test accounts later.<br />

This determines what time is displayed to the user.<br />

This determines what language <strong>Moodle</strong> uses for its interface. There is<br />

a site-wide setting that allows or forbids users from selecting their own<br />

language. If you plan to allow users to select their own language, their<br />

selection will overwrite what you choose here.<br />

Most sites allow users to enter their own Description in their user profile.<br />

You can enter a starting description here.<br />

8. The remainder of the user fields are self-explanatory. Usually, they are filled<br />

out by the user.<br />

9. In your word processor, take note of the user's username, password, and<br />

email address. You'll need these later.<br />

10. At the bottom of the page, click on the Update profile button. This saves<br />

the profile.<br />

11. Repeat this for each of your test users. When you finish, you will see them<br />

listed under Settings | Site administration | Users | Accounts | Browse<br />

list of users, as shown i the example below:<br />
